Harrington Starr have recently partnered with a fast growing, Trading solutions company based in London. They are looking for a Graduate Application Support Analyst with great technical knowledge to support their clients' business applications. This role looks at supporting clients both within London and within the EMEA region.
The role will involve providing level 1 support. This role has a lot of career scope and provides the right person with an opportunity to progress. There is on-going training provided in order to ensure you are able to be as confident with new technologies.
The role requires the following:
- Motivated to break into the Financial IT space.
- Recent Graduate/ Entry Level.
- Experience with Linux command lines.
- Being keen to work in a Support role.
- Good level of communication and motivation to learn and expand their knowledge within the Trading space.
